wsl2改变系统位置
2026/4/9小于 1 分钟
wsl2改变系统位置
以docker为例
docker desktop在启动时会默认安装docker-desktop 和 docker-desktop-data两个子系统,现在想要把这两个子系统全部从c盘迁移到h盘
查看WSL分发版本
wsl -l --all -v导出分发版为tar文件到d盘
wsl --export docker-desktop H:\wsl-os-image\docker-desktop.tarwsl --export docker-desktop-data H:\wsl-os-image\docker-desktop-data.tar注销当前分发版
wsl --unregister docker-desktopwsl --unregister docker-desktop-data重新导入并安装WSL在H:\wsl-os-image
wsl --import docker-desktop H:\docker-workspace H:\wsl-os-image\docker-desktop.tarwsl --import docker-desktop-data H:\docker-data H:\wsl-os-image\docker-desktop-data.tar设置默认登陆用户为安装时用户名
ubuntu2004 config --default-user Username
删除tar文件(可选)
del d:\wsl-ubuntu20.04.tar